A compact hideaway located in an undisturbed stone cottage; this accommodation choice is an appealing haven for two. Romance is assured in this bijou place, with a sumptuous rolltop bath in the king-size bedroom and a warming wood burner to snuggle up in front of when the temperature drops. Surrounded by the impressive scenery of Hartland Point, a heritage coast area, this property puts you within easy reach of beautiful beaches, clifftop viewpoints and appealing villages in both Devon and Cornwall. Whilst the lively destination of Bude is just a short 7-mile drive down the coast, the Devonshire towns of Westward Ho! and Bideford are also not too far away (within 20 miles).

Stylish features, stone-flagged flooring and contemporary design elements add to the instant appeal of this single-storey place. Spend time in the open-plan living area with a lounge, kitchen and diner in one neat row, complete with a wood burner tucked away in the corner and a basket of logs to get you going. Switch on the Smart TV to enjoy music or film whilst cooking, eating or relaxing with your feet up. Next door, a smart king-size bedroom is laid out with an en-suite WC next door. The free-standing bath is a place to soak in the bedroom when the night draws in. Completing the property, a private patio at the rear is furnished for alfresco evenings.

A destination for walkers or cyclists, this property sits 3 miles from the famed South West Coast Path with excursions leading north and south along Devon and Cornwall’s coastal attractions. Fantastic beaches including Welcombe Mouth (8 miles) and Sandymouth Bay (4 miles) are close by, as are the ever-popular destinations of Crooklets and Summerleaze on the edge of Bude town centre (7 miles). Bude also benefits from a sea pool for freshwater swimming in safe conditions.
